a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orRoss Burton <ross.burton@intel.com>2018-03-02 20:53:10 +0000
committerRichard Purdie <richard.purdie@linuxfoundation.org>2018-03-30 10:11:19 +0100
commit14269b953c1f74d7dd72c65df5e925d9ae4e75be (patch)
treeef39aa5b614e641d3341555f809718d46176468e
parent13ad745bf40a5e3e08a4e1f3295353b395eec43d (diff)
downloadopenembedded-core-14269b953c1f74d7dd72c65df5e925d9ae4e75be.tar.gz
openembedded-core-14269b953c1f74d7dd72c65df5e925d9ae4e75be.tar.bz2
openembedded-core-14269b953c1f74d7dd72c65df5e925d9ae4e75be.zip
sdk: only install locales if we're using glibc
Using glibc-locale to install locales only makes sense if we're using glibc. (From OE-Core rev: 8fc80734053645fa893694dfe33ddaee99aa9a1a) Signed-off-by: Ross Burton <ross.burton@intel.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
-rw-r--r--meta/lib/oe/sdk.py4
1 files changed, 4 insertions, 0 deletions
diff --git a/meta/lib/oe/sdk.py b/meta/lib/oe/sdk.py
index 6f10139a5a..e0e2086f85 100644
--- a/meta/lib/oe/sdk.py
+++ b/meta/lib/oe/sdk.py
@@ -85,6 +85,10 @@ class Sdk(object, metaclass=ABCMeta):
bb.warn("cannot remove SDK dir: %s" % path)
def install_locales(self, pm):
+ # This is only relevant for glibc
+ if self.d.getVar("TCLIBC") != "glibc":
+ return
+
linguas = self.d.getVar("SDKIMAGE_LINGUAS")
if linguas:
if linguas == "all":